1. Manage Accounts

When registering for TikTok, users can register by using a phone number or email. How to protect TikTok accounts from piracy is quite easy, because TikTok presents its own security system for the convenience of users on the Manage Account menu.

Here's how to protect your TikTok account from piracy:

Tap the dot three at the top right Then press the option "Manage accounts" Then press "Password" Create a password to protect your account. After that you will receive a text message to authenticate the addition of the password. 2. Take advantage of the Privacy and Security Features

These settings are for managing your account permissions and access. When you first create a TikTok account, your account will automatically be "Public". User can change it to "Private". Here's how to change a TikTok account to a Private account:

Press the three dots in the upper right corner to enter the settings and privacy features. Tap the words "Privacy", then swipe to the right of the circle next to the "Private account" menu.

In this privacy menu users can also turn off a number of features "Suggest your account to others." TikTok also provides users with other security options.

Now, any spam or rude messages that come from trolls will be limited by your contact list. To limit unwanted messages, turn off direct messaging.

Users can also give permission whether they can duet with other users or not, if they don't want to, then disable it or limit it to friends only. In this Privacy setting, users can allow other people to see what the user likes or doesn't like. Apart from that, you can also limit comments, which users are allowed to comment.

3. 2-Step Verification

The way to protect TikTok users' accounts is by activating the 2-step verification feature. This feature serves to verify who will log into the user's account. Here's how to enable two-step verification on TikTok:

Press the three dots in the top right corner. Tap the "Security" menu. Enable 2-step verification by sliding the white circle to the right.

Users will get an SMS message every time someone logs into their account. Well, this is what will make TikTok users avoid piracy. That's how to protect your TikTok account from piracy.
